Understanding Europe's Forest Harvesting Regimes
European forests are being shaped by active human use and management, and by harvesting of wood in particular. Yet, our understanding of how forests are harvested across Europe is limited, as the real harvest regimes are not well described by currently available data.

Deep Reinforcement Learning Approaches for Sensor Data Collection by a Swarm of UAVs
This article presents four decentralized reinforcement learning algorithms for autonomous data harvesting and investigates how collaboration improves collection efficiency. It also presents strategies to minimize training times by improving model flexibility, enabling algorithms to operate with varying number of agents and sensors.
